Best 17103 Pennsylvania Public High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 1,343 students in 17103, PA.
The top-ranked public high school in 17103, PA is Harrisburg High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public high school in zipcode 17103 have an average math proficiency score of 5% (versus the Pennsylvania public high school average of 30%), and reading proficiency score of 17% (versus the 58% statewide average). High schools in 17103, PA have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Pennsylvania public high schools.
Public high school in zipcode 17103 have a Graduation Rate of 62%, which is less than the Pennsylvania average of 88%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Harrisburg High School, with 62%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Pennsylvania or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 97%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Pennsylvania public high school average of 40% (majority Hispanic and Black).
